The School of International Relations welcomes interest from any internal or external candidates who wish to apply for a UK Research and Innovation (UKRI) Future Leaders Fellowship (FLF) with the University of St Andrews as their host organisation.

These fellowships are for early career academics and innovators who are transitioning to or establishing independence. The fellowships support applicants from diverse career backgrounds, including those returning from a career break or returning to research following time in other roles. There are no time limits in respect of time spent outside a research or innovation environment. 

The FLF Scheme has already funded fellowships from £300,000 to over £2m, and there is no preference for lower or higher costed proposals. The UKRI FLF scheme provides a comprehensive, yet flexible, package of support in any research area supported by UKRI. The scheme aims to enable the next generation of researchers and innovators to benefit from this outstanding support to develop their careers, and to work on difficult and novel challenges in ambitious programmes of research.

Due to the competitive nature of theses fellowships, the University will select and submit a maximum of four high quality applications which must first be nominated by a host School/Department.
